Whenever you visit or interact with the Website or its content, we and our designated service providers, which may include third party analytics service providers such as Educational Testing Service, may use cookies to collect website traffic and performance data. Cookies are small files that a site or its service provider transfers to your computer’s hard drive through your Web browser to enable the site or service provider’s systems to recognize your browser and capture and remember certain information. These cookies may track things like your IP address, the type of operating system and Web browser you use and related information. We, and our service providers, also automatically track certain information about your activities on the Websites such as the pages you visit and how you arrived at our site. You can delete and block cookies via your Web browser’s settings. Note that the Website may not function correctly without cookies.
